🐞Библиотека QA
6.1K subscribers
333 photos
3 videos
83 files
327 links
Книги по тестированию ПО для QA инженеров.

Все размещенные материалы представлены исключительно для ознакомления.

По всем вопросам: @anothertechrock
Download Telegram
Основы тестирования программного обеспечения

▫️Автор: В. П. Котляров
▫️Год: 2016, обновляется
▫️Страниц: 360

▫️Аннотация
Курс посвящен обсуждению проблем контроля качества разработки программного обеспечения с позиций тестирования. Задачей курса, реализующейся через лекционный материал и практикум, является подготовка тестировщиков программного проекта. Предлагаемый вашему вниманию курс обобщает опыт многолетней работы учебного центра "Политехник - Моторола" в Санкт-Петербургском государственном политехническом университете. Основные темы лекционного курса: основные понятия тестирования: терминология тестирования, различия тестирования и отладки, фазы и технология тестирования, проблемы тестирования, критерии выбора тестов: структурные, функциональные, стохастические, мутационный, оценки покрытия проекта, разновидности тестирования: модульное, интеграционное, системное, регрессионное, автоматизация тестирования, издержки тестирования, особенности процесса и технологии индустриального тестирования: планирование тестирования, подходы к разработке тестов, особенности ручной разработки и генерации тестов, автоматизация тестового цикла, документирование тестирования, обзоры и метрики, регрессионное тестирование: особенности и виды регрессионного тестирования, методы отбора тестов, оценка эффективности, терминологический словарь: содержит глоссарий терминологии тестирования в соответствии с IEEE Standard Glossary of Software Engineering.

▫️Древняя книга, но актуальная

Скачать книгу
Please open Telegram to view this post
VIEW IN TELEGRAM
Проджект-менеджер — это человек, который может провести трёхчасовой митинг, чтобы договориться о следующем митинге.

План на спринт есть всегда. Просто команда о нём узнаёт за день до демо.


PM Юмор — канал, где дедлайны горят, а шутки летят.
Testing in Python

Robust Testing For Professionals

Автор: Ной Гифт
Год: 2020

Начать тестирование может быть нелегко, и эта книга призвана упростить задачу, используя примеры и доходчиво объясняя процесс. Тестирование - это основной принцип создания надежного программного обеспечения, и его освоение должно быть одним из основных навыков, который можно применить в любом проекте.

Скачать книгу
Please open Telegram to view this post
VIEW IN TELEGRAM
У всех на слуху AI, а как с внедрением на деле?

2ГИС узнал, что, например, тестировщики пока осторожничают: суммарно 57% пока не интегрировали нейросети в рабочие процессы. Наиболее популярные практические сценарии — помощь в написании тестового кода, генерация тест-кейсов и тестовых данных.

Больше данных про сферу QA — в свежем исследовании
Формула прибыли.
Главные цифры вашего бизнеса.


Автор: Илья Балахнин
Год издания: 2019

#pm #ru

Скачать книгу
Performance Testing

An ISTQB Certified Tester Foundation Level Specialist Certification Review

Автор: Кит Йоркстон
Год: 2021

Используйте эту книгу для подготовки к экзамену ISTQB® Certified Tester Foundation Level Performance Testing. Книга разработана в соответствии с учебной программой ISTQB и охватывает все учебные цели программы, а также дополнительные справочные материалы, выходящие за рамки программы. В книге рассматривается общая методология управления и проведения тестирования производительности.
Тестирование производительности часто считалось черным искусством. Во многих организациях, возможно, отдельному человеку или небольшой группе технических сотрудников или подрядчиков дается задание "нагрузить" расширенную систему, сеть или приложение.
Тестирование производительности похоже на любую другую форму тестирования. Оно следует определенному процессу тестирования, который похож на другие виды тестирования. Оно использует дисциплинированный подход к определению требований и пользовательских историй, созданию условий тестирования, тестовых случаев и процедур тестирования. Он устанавливает измеримые цели, по которым можно судить об успехе или неудаче тестирования. Также требуется (и это нельзя не подчеркнуть) определение и признание неудач тестирования производительности.

Читатели получат знания как по содержанию, так и по практическим вопросам, чтобы подготовиться к экзамену ISQTB Performance Testing. Книга охватывает типы тестов производительности, методологию тестирования производительности, а также шаги по планированию, созданию и выполнению тестов производительности и анализу результатов.

🟢Скачать книгу
Please open Telegram to view this post
VIEW IN TELEGRAM
Pro Git (на русском)

Авторы:
Скотт Чакон, Бен Штрауб
Год: 2019

Аннотация
Вся книга Pro Git, написанная Скоттом Чаконом и Беном Страубом и опубликованная издательством Apress, доступна здесь. Все содержание книги распространяется по лицензии Creative Commons Attribution Non Commercial Share Alike 3.0.

Скачать книгу
Please open Telegram to view this post
VIEW IN TELEGRAM
Управление продуктом в Scrum

Автор: Пихлер Роман
Год издания: 2017

#pm #scrum #ru

Скачать книгу
Selenium: Web Browser Automation"

Сборник туториалов сайта TutorialsPoint

Год: 2023, обновляется
190 страниц, охвачено все необходимое для новичка

Сайт TutorialsPoint должен быть хорошо известен самоучкам, а также студентам QA-курсов.
Чтобы не листать сотни страниц на сайте, удобнее скачать весь туториал в PDF.

Такие туториалы, составленные сайтами, могут быть намного полезнее, чем книги издательств, поскольку непрерывно обновляются и корректируются, и ориентированы на практику, а не на теорию (постоянно устаревающую).

Скачать книгу
Please open Telegram to view this post
VIEW IN TELEGRAM
🎯 Podlodka QA Crew: QA Tooling — онлайн-конференция о том, как инструменты меняют тестирование.

С 1 по 5 сентября QA-инженеры соберутся онлайн, чтобы обсудить, как использовать AI, DevOps-подходы и новые тулзы, чтобы тестировать быстрее и качественнее.

В программе:

🛠️Как с помощью скриптов и AI ускорять и автоматизировать рутину (Надя Дебогори, Supplied)

Тесты, которые пишут сами себя: AI в действии (Сергей Виноградов, Yandex)

🧩 Контейнеры и кластеры для QA без боли и магии (Николай Акулов, Anna Money)

🔍Работа с WebSocket-сообщениями: перехват и модификация (Арман Мурадян, ВКонтакте)

Все доклады — прикладные, с практикой и инструментами.

📍1–5 сентября, онлайн.
🔗 Подробнее и билеты: https://podlodka.io/qacrew
«Принцип 80/20». Ричард Коч

О чём книга

Главная идея книги в том, что 20% усилий приносят 80% результатов. Автор объясняет, как применять эту модель в бизнесе, жизни и продуктивности.

Чем полезна
Помогает управлять приоритетами, ресурсами и временем. Особенно актуальна, если вы работаете в условиях многозадачности.

Что пишут в сети
«Я прочитал книгу и она мне понравилась. Я слышал о принципе 80/20 раньше и видел примеры его применения в бизнесе и жизни. Что я извлек из нее больше всего, так это сосредоточить свое внимание и усилия на действиях, которые приносят вам наилучшие результаты», — пишет пользователь cashionaytor на reddit.

Скачать для ознакомления (PDF)
Софт за 30 дней. Как Scrum делает
невозможное возможным.


Автор: Швабер Кен
Год издания: 2017

#pm #scrum #ru

Скачать книгу
Хотите получить оффер за 3 дня и присоединиться к команде YADRO TELECOM? ➡️

SPRINT OFFER QA Automation Engineer
1️⃣ Оставьте заявку до 7 сентября и пройдите HR-скрининг.
2️⃣ Пройдите техническое и менеджерское интервью.
3️⃣ Получите оффер за 3 дня.

О команде 🚀

В YADRO команда Телеком создаёт телекоммуникационные решения для мобильных сетей и разрабатывает первые российские базовые станции. Более 200 специалистов работают над тестированием, автоматизацией и улучшением качества продуктов, создавая удобные инструменты для команды QA.

Направления, которым вы нужны 😊

Инженеры AQA занимаются тестированием систем: начиная с анализа требований и заканчивая разработкой тестового фреймворка и симулятора.

Работа ведется в нескольких направлениях: LTE Box Testing, система управления и мониторинга (NMS), ядро мобильной связи 5G.

💙 Готовы стать частью масштабных проектов и присоединиться к YADRO? Скорее оставляйте заявку - принимаем до 7 сентября!
Please open Telegram to view this post
VIEW IN TELEGRAM
🚀 Митап по QA: Тестирование без рутины: практики, кейсы, инструменты

Приглашаем вас на онлайн-митап, где мы обсудим практики и инструменты, которые помогают командам тестирования ускорять процессы, повышать качество и находить новые подходы к автоматизации.

Программа митапа:

✔️ Кухня регрессионного тестирования: как за 20 минут подать то, что раньше готовили две недели — Анастасия Давыдкина и Александр Вдовин, Ви.Tech

Когда-то полный регресс занимал две недели, требовал ручной работы трёх тестировщиков и всё равно пропускал баги. Сейчас он идёт всего 20 минут, а релизы выкатываются по четыре раза в день.
Разберём:

- С чего начать автоматизацию,
- Как держать автотесты стабильными,
- Как ускорить прогоны,
- И какие ошибки мы допустили, чтобы вы их не повторяли.

✔️ Эра умной валидации: нам всё ещё нужны ассерты? — Алексей Коледачкин

Ассерты — фундамент тестирования, но с приходом AI появляется второй контур, который ловит смысловые ошибки не только в ответе, но и в запросах.
На докладе вы узнаете:

- Где хватает классики, а где AI-валидация реально спасает,
- Как работает requests-ai-validator (правила, схема, код на 10 строк),
- Какие есть метрики и рамки безопасности: время, качество, приватность.

✔️ Как автоматизировать рутину и освободить время на важное — Артем Ерошенко, сооснователь Qameta Software

Каждый день мы тратим часы на повторяющиеся задачи. В мастер-классе разберём, как с помощью n8n построить рабочие процессы без кода.
Покажем:

- Настройку автоматизации за час,
- Создание Telegram-бота,
- Интеграции с инструментами команды.

➡️ Модератор: Олег Шмелев Ви.Tech, QA Head
➡️ Эксперт: Алексей Иванов, 2ГИС, QA Automation Engineer

🗓 25 сентября (четверг), 19:00 мск Онлайн

Ссылка на регистрацию
Please open Telegram to view this post
VIEW IN TELEGRAM
Fundamentals of Software Testing

Автор: Bernard Homès
Год: 2024
Страниц:
384

Аннотация

С момента выхода первого издания этой книги в 2011 году тестирование программного обеспечения претерпело значительные изменения. Теперь от тестировщиков требуется работать в "agile" командах и сосредоточиться на автоматизации тестовых случаев. Поэтому возникла необходимость обновить эту работу, чтобы предоставить фундаментальные знания, которыми должны обладать тестировщики, чтобы быть эффективными и результативными в современном мире.
В этой книге описываются фундаментальные аспекты тестирования в различных жизненных циклах, а также то, как применять и извлекать пользу из обзоров и статического анализа. Рассматривается множество других методик, таких как разбиение на эквивалентности, анализ граничных значений, тестирование сценариев использования, таблицы принятия решений и переходы состояний.
Во втором издании также рассматриваются вопросы управления тестированием, мониторинга хода тестирования и управления инцидентами, чтобы обеспечить правильное предоставление информации о тестировании заинтересованным сторонам.
Книга содержит подробный материал для изучения версии 2023 года учебной программы ISTQB Foundation, включая примеры вопросов для подготовки к экзаменам.

Об авторе
Бернар Хомес, старший член IEEE, имеет более чем 30-летний опыт разработки и тестирования программного обеспечения в критических для безопасности областях (аэронавтика, аэрокосмическая промышленность, медицина и телекоммуникации). Известный консультант и докладчик, был координатором и автором учебной программы ISTQB продвинутого уровня и предоставляет специализированные услуги по тестированию для международных клиентов.

Скачать книгу
Please open Telegram to view this post
VIEW IN TELEGRAM
Testing Microservices with Mountebank

Автор:
Brandon Byars
Год: 2019
Страниц: 240

Аннотация
Testing Microservices with Mountebank - это руководство по тестированию микросервисов с виртуализацией сервисов. Книга предлагает уникальные знания о проектировании приложений микросервисов и современные методы тестирования, которые позволят углубить ваши навыки работы с микросервисами и усовершенствовать ваши приложения.

Что внутри
Основные концепции виртуализации сервисов
Тестирование с использованием консервированных ответов
Программирование Mountebank
Тестирование производительности

О читателе
Написана для разработчиков, знакомых с SOA или системами микросервисов.

Об авторе
Брендон Байарс - автор и главный мейнтейнер Mountebank, а также главный консультант ThoughtWorks.

Оглавление
ЧАСТЬ 1 - ПЕРВЫЕ ШАГИ
Тестирование микросервисов
Тест-драйв Mountebank
ЧАСТЬ 2 - ИСПОЛЬЗОВАНИЕ MOUNTEBANK
Тестирование с помощью консервированных ответов
Использование предикатов для отправки различных ответов
Добавление поведения записи/воспроизведения
Программирование Mountebank
Добавление поведения
Протоколы
ЧАСТЬ 3 - ЗАКРЫТИЕ
Mountebank и непрерывная доставка
Тестирование производительности с mountebank

Скачать книгу
Please open Telegram to view this post
VIEW IN TELEGRAM
«В IT сейчас работы нет» — слышали такое?

А вот и нет 🙅‍♂️ Мы каждый день публикуем новые, живые вакансии с вилкой и прямыми контактами рекрутеров в телеграм.

Подборки для всех направлений — от джуна до лида.
Есть даже еженедельные интерншипы и стажировки для начинающих.

🔎 Выбирай свой канал:

QA → @qa_work
PM →
@jobs_pm
BA/SA →
@analytics_jobs
.NET →
@job_dotnet
DS/ML →
@dsml_jobs
PHP →
@work_php
Java →
@java_dev_job
Python →
@jobrocket_python

🧩 Или подпишись сразу на все
👑 Кто работает PM — тот в цирке не смеется

Наша сегодняшняя рекомендация — канал с PM юмором.

Мы работаем в проджект-менеджменте и уже не смеемся. Но если вас можно рассмешить welcome в PM Humor
Тестирование программного обеспечения

Автор: Игнатьев А. В.
Год: 2023
Страниц: 56

Учебное пособие посвящено вопросам анализа, планирования, проведения тестовых испытаний и оценки качества программного обеспечения на всех стадиях его жизненного цикла. Является методическим обеспечением выполнения лабораторных работ для студентов средних профессиональных учреждений, обучающихся по специальностям направления подготовки «Информационная безопасность» и «Информатика и вычислительная техника». Соответствует современным требованиям Федерального государственного образовательного стандарта среднего профессионального образования и профессиональным квалификационным требованиям.

Скачать книгу
Please open Telegram to view this post
VIEW IN TELEGRAM
Когда QA ограничивается только тест-кейсами и автотестами, легко упустить главное — реальное качество продукта. А оно проверяется не в CI, а на проде.

В новом материале рассказываем, как в 2ГИС тестировщики участвуют в дежурствах наравне с разработкой:

📍 разбирают инциденты,

📍 анализируют причины сбоев,

📍 вносят улучшения в архитектуру и процессы.

Показываем на примерах, как это работает, какие навыки нужны и как такой подход меняет мышление — от «проверить» к «предотвратить».

➡️ Читайте статью на Хабре и делитесь, как у вас устроена поддержка продакшена
Тестирование программного обеспечения. Основы

▪️На русском
▪️Автор:
Захаров В.В.
▪️Год: 2024 🔥
▪️Страниц: 237 стр., 79 иллюстраций

▪️Автор о себе:
В области ИТ работаю более 17 лет из них опыт управления подразделениями более 13 лет, в том числе распределёнными командами. В тестировании работаю c 2008 года. Прошёл путь от специалиста по тестированию до руководителя крупного подразделения.

▪️Аннотация:
Погрузитесь в увлекательный мир тестирования программного обеспечения вместе с книгой, которая является настоящим концентратом чистейших знаний для новичков и профессионалов! Автор делится секретами мастерства, подробно рассказывая о более 15 видах тестирования и более 20 методах проектирования тестов (техниках тест-дизайна). И это только вершина айсберга знаний, изложенных в книге. Вы будете поражены глубиной информации и открытием знаний собранных в одном месте, о которых даже не догадывались. Книга насыщена ценнейшими советами, основанными на практическом опыте. Многочисленные примеры помогут быстрее освоить представленный в книге материал. Вооружившись знаниями из этой книги, вы будете уверенно разбираться в нюансах тестирования программного обеспечения и с лёгкостью применять знания на практике! Книга может по праву считаться настольной книгой специалиста по тестированию.

▪️Учебные материалы:
Пример плана тестирования.
Пример отчёта о тестировании.
Международный стандарт ISO/IEC/IEEE 29119-4 от 2015 года.
ISTQB Foundation Level Syllabus версия 4 от 2023 года.

▪️Рейтинг на Литресе: 4,6/5

Скачать книгу
Please open Telegram to view this post
VIEW IN TELEGRAM